概括
这项研究引入了公共汽车停留时间,以减少公共汽车在实时运输控制中的拥挤. 优化策略减少了45%的公共汽车捆绑,乘客等待时间减少了30%.
科学领域:
- 运营研究 运营研究
- 运输工程 运输工程
- 应用数学 应用数学 应用数学
背景情况:
- 公共汽车快速运输 (BRT) 系统面临实时运营挑战,包括公共汽车捆绑.
- 尽量减少头到尾巴的距离和同时到达的距离对于服务效率至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 开发和评估BRT系统的新控制策略,以减轻公共汽车集群.
- 通过优化巴士停留时间,最大限度地减少巴士捆绑处罚,并改善乘客体验.
主要方法:
- 制定了一个新的数学模型,使用二次制约和线性目标函数来确定最佳的公共汽车停留时间.
- 开发了一种光束搜索启发式,以有效地解决优化问题的大规模实例.
主要成果:
- 与未经优化场景相比,模拟显示,与非优化场景相比,公共汽车捆绑减少了45%.
- 在特定的模拟条件下,乘客等待时间减少了高达30%.
- 在真实世界的实例中,光束搜索启发式在不到3秒的时间内实现了<5%的最佳差距的解决方案.
结论:
- 实施巴士停留时间是BRT系统有效的实时控制策略.
- 拟议的数学模型和启发式方法提供了一种计算效率高的方法,以减少公共汽车捆绑并提高交通服务质量.

The Power Flow Problem and Solution
211
Power flow problem analysis is fundamental for determining real and reactive power flows in network components, such as transmission lines, transformers, and loads. The power system's single-line diagram provides data on the bus, transmission line, and transformer. Fast Decoupled and DC Powerflow
191
The fast decoupled power flow method addresses contingencies in power system operations, such as generator outages or transmission line failures. This method provides quick power flow solutions, essential for real-time system adjustments.
